Police Warn About Missing Person Facebook Post, Hoax/Virus

Elkton, MD– Elkton Police posted a notice on their Facebook page warning citizens not to open a missing person post.

DO NOT OPEN A POST THAT IS BEING CIRCULATED ON FACEBOOK REGARDING A MISSING DEKALB GIRL. Her name is allegedly Kitty Collins. THIS IS A HOAX and a virus may be attached to this link. It may also lead you to a website where your personal or financial information could be stolen.

We do not have a report of a Kitty Collins missing from this department. “Kitty Collins” also appears to be a missing person in other communities that have different pictures attached to her name.

As always, use caution when such posts do not come from legitimate sites.
